shepherds pie - easy irish comfort food

as i alluded to in my previous post, this weekend, i made shepherds pie. it was fantastic and easy to make. learn how to cook with angry ninja! heres how:

prep time: approx 45 minutes.

ingredients:

  • 1.5 lb lean ground beef
  • 1 red or yellow onion (diced)
  • 4 white mushrooms (sliced)
  • worcestershire seasoning
  • a little bit of milk/cream
  • 4 medium - large potatoes
  • i bunch cilantro
  • 1 egg
  • salt, pepper, seasoning salt, butter

directions:

  • peel and quarter the potatoes and dump them into boiling water.
  • saute onions with 1-2 tbs of oil, when done, add the ground beef and brown.
  • season meat and onion with worcestershire seasoning , salt, pepper, and seasoning salt. you can add a little bit of soy sauce or tomato sauce for taste.
  • when meat is almost browned, add in the mushrooms and cilantro. finish and set aside. set oven to preheat at 350
  • by this time, your potatoes should be ready for mashing. mash with butter milk/cream and salt to taste.
  • scoop your meat skillet into a casserole dish or brownie tin.
  • top and spread mashed potatoes on top of the meat layer.
  • crack open and egg and brush it over the mashed potato layer
  • pop casserole dish/brownie tin into the oven for 30 minutes.

pizza + omelette = awesome brinner

last night was pizza night. when that happens, i usually have a bunch of toppings left over. while surveying the fridge tonight, i had a revelation: i love pizza. i love omelettes. i have leftover pizza toppings. time to make a pizza omelette.

follow these simple instructions to make your own awesome brinner. prep time: approx 25 minutes.

ingredients needed:

  1. 2 eggs
  2. 1/4 green pepper (chopped)
  3. 1/4 red onion (chopped)
  4. 7-9 slices of pepperoni
  5. 2 sliced mushrooms
  6. handful of spinach
  7. shredded mozzarella (to taste)
  8. tater tots (however many you think you can eat)

directions:

  1. preheat the oven for the tater tots. while the oven is heating, chop up your onions, bell peppers, and mushrooms.
  2. beat eggs in a bowl.
  3. youll have a few minutes here. turn on tv and catch up on the nba playoffs.
  4. after the oven has heated, place the tater tots on a baking tray and insert in oven. these should take about 20 minutes.
  5. when there are 10-12 minutes left until the tots are done, sauté the ingredients you prepared in the first step.
  6. when the onions begin to turn translucent, add the spinach and the pepperoni. there should be about 6 minutes left until the tots are done.
  7. when spinach and pepperoni look ready, add the eggs. flip when necessary.
  8. top with mozerella and ketchup if desired. add tots on the side.
  9. plate and garnish.
  10. grab a fork and enjoy!

if you followed the directions, you should come up with something that looks kinda like the image below.
